If 1 card is drawn at random from a standard 52-card deck, what is the probability that the card drawn is a king?

Answer:

1/13 chance or roughly 7.7% chance.

Step-by-step explanation:

There are 4 Kings in a standard 52-card deck. If one King was to be pulled out, you'd get a probability of 4/52 chance of pulling a king. Simplified, 4/52 is  1/13 chance.
